On Tax Reform: Does not back tax bill; not enough benefit to middle class

Richard Cordray, a Democrat running for governor in Ohio described the tax bill as a "terrible deal" that helps the wealthy. In a speech Cordray told the audience about his efforts to help consumers and fight big banks while serving as the first director of the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au. When an audience member asked Cordray to weigh in on the federal tax bill that was in the works at the time (it later became law), he said it wouldn't do enough to help the middle class.
